The idea for the covers came about on the Forum, of course. Irene and I, along with several others, were joking around about things we could give the cast, in a “roast” kind of fashion, using dialogue from the show. I started with the idea of books and then suddenly realized, how the hell was I going to get all these books from the Berkshires to NYC? I knew I couldn’t carry them on the train. So, I decided, in this age of computers, how about cd’s?? “And why not?” So, on the 21st, I started my three-hour ride to the city! Off I went to the train station with 15 cd’s “For Dummies” in my bag, along with some other things for the cast and OH WHAT A NIGHT —- THE WHOLE WORLD EXPLODED for all of us fans!

“The Oscars, the Emmy’s, you can buy that sh*t, THESE are from THE FANS!!!!”

JOHN LLOYD YOUNG: “HOW TO BE BIGGER THAN SINATRA AND NOT HAVE TO STAND ON A CHAIR – FOR DUMMIES” – with Introduction by Frank Sinatra – with Bonus: How to get your car back Jersey style

CHRISTIAN HOFF: “HOW TO GIVE A LITTLE GUIDANCE AND MAKE IT YOUR MISSION” – FOR DUMMIES” – My Hand to God

BOBBY SPENCER: “HOW TO START YOUR OWN GROUP – FOR DUMMIES” – with introduction by Ringo Starr

DANIEL REICHARD: “HOW TO RACK UP A PERSONAL FIRST, SO NOW I’M A LOVER – FOR DUMMIES” – with introduction by Frankie, Nicky and Tommy – also: How to be a one hit wonder and give a f**k about your neighborhood.

JENNIFER NAIMO: “WHY IS “Y” A BULLSH*T LETTER? – FOR DUMMIES”- JBADDF (Jersey Boys Addiction Distraction Disorder Fans) Publications – with “four” word by Frankie, Bobby, Tommy and Nicky – Dedicated to: Type “A” Mary (Jennifer Naimo) Delgado — Jennifer also received a martini……..actually, a candle that is in a real martini glass complete with olive and festive umbrella

SARA SCHMIDT: “HOW TO IMPROVE YOUR MIND: READ THE BIBLE AND BECOME A SINGING ANGEL – FOR DUMMIES” – Forward by Nick Massi – Introduction by the cast of The Blob — Sara also received a DVD of “The Blob.”

ERICA PICCININI: “HOW TO GET OFF THE MERRY-GO-ROUND AND BE #1 – FOR DUMMIES” – Introduction by A Coupla Chinese Twins – Bonus: How not to get hit on by Tommy DeVito — Erica also received A Coupla Chinese Twins

HEATHER FURGUSON: “MARY? LORRAINE? FRANCINE? WHO AM I? – FOR DUMMIES” – How to get your time on stage

MICHAEL LONGORIA: “HOW TO MAKE PEOPLE BELIEVE YOU’RE A F**KING GENIUS – FOR DUMMIES” – with introduction by Joe Pesci — with Bonus: Joe Pesci sings Short Shorts

DONNIE KEHR: “HOW TO GET TO BLOOMFIELD – FOR DUMMIES” – with Bonus map of Fairfield — with Introduction by Norm Waxman

MARK LOTITO: “YOU DO A FAVAH FAH ME, I DO A FAVAH FAH YOU – FOR DUMMIES” – with Introduction by Gyp DeCarlo

PETER GREGUS: “HOW TO GET TO BLOOMFIELD VIA FAIRFIELD – FOR DUMMIES” – with Bonus map of every jewelry store in between – also: How to do your chart when the stars are in alignment.

KRIS COLEMAN: “HOW TO GET YOURSELF A LOVE MUFFIN AND KEEP HER – FOR DUMMIES” – with Introduction by Tommy, Frankie, Bobby and Nickey, Cell Block 6

And for our very own IRENE EIZEN: “OUR EYES ADORE YOU IRENE EIZEN – YOU MADE THE PLAN HAPPEN” – with our love and gratitude, Irene, from all JB fans!
